Dentin matrix protein 1 (DMP1) is a bone-and teeth-specific protein initially identified from
mineralized dentin. Here we report that DMP1 is primarily localized in the nuclear
compartment of undifferentiated osteoblasts. In the nucleus, DMP1 acts as a transcriptional
component for activation of osteoblast-specific genes like osteocalcin. During the early
phase of osteoblast maturation, Ca 2+ surges into the nucleus from the cytoplasm, triggering
